Output 34dab95fa17fd2593466f9e5f336cf9158a022decd8ec3cedcb5edd4e2a33972:2

value
403450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8d2f4df6ce0bad0ed53df7f0607bf739dc574d OP_EQUAL
address
3N53k1grH8prssYCt6ne5fHUzbfq9SR6u9
transaction
34dab95fa17fd2593466f9e5f336cf9158a022decd8ec3cedcb5edd4e2a33972
spent
true